The small scale preparation of thiokol rubber this preparation of thiokol rubber is a two step process.
Polysulfide rubber is a synthetic rubber that is a product of the polycondensation of dihalides of aliphatic compounds e g ethylene dichloride or propyl dichloride with polysulfides of alkali metals e g na 2 s x where x 2 4.
